About the role#
As a Hunyuan Multimodal Algorithm Researcher Intern, you will work on the research and development of Omni multimodal large models. This role involves the full lifecycle of model development, from data construction and foundational algorithm design to pre-training, fine-tuning, and reinforcement learning optimization. You will evaluate model capabilities and explore downstream application scenarios to ensure the competitiveness of our technology.
What you'll do#
- Design and construct training data for large-scale multimodal models.
- Identify performance bottlenecks and develop solutions based on first principles to accelerate model iteration.
- Research next-generation model architectures to advance understanding and generation capabilities.
- Push the boundaries of current multimodal models through the exploration of diverse paradigms.
What you'll need#
- Bachelor degree or higher in Computer Science, Artificial Intelligence, Mathematics, or related fields (graduate degrees are prioritized).
- Solid foundation in deep learning algorithms with practical experience in large model development.
- Hands-on experience in large-scale multimodal data processing and high-quality data generation.
- Proficiency in deep learning implementation details, including model tuning, CPU/GPU acceleration, and distributed training or inference optimization.
- Familiarity with Diffusion Models and Autoregressive Models is advantageous.
- Participation in ACM or NOI competitions is highly valued.
- Strong learning agility, communication skills, and teamwork.

About Tencent
Tencent is a technology company founded in 1998 and based in Shenzhen, China. It operates across several sectors including online gaming, social networking, and digital content. The company provides cloud computing, advertising, and financial services to enterprise clients. It currently employs over 89,000 people and maintains a presence in multiple international markets.
